Understanding the Importance of Teamwork

Teamwork is essential in sales because it combines the strengths of individual team members to achieve common goals. When team members collaborate, they share their unique skills, knowledge, and experiences. This collective effort not only improves the overall performance but also creates a supportive environment where everyone can thrive.

Enhancing Communication

One of the biggest benefits of collaboration is improved communication. When team members communicate effectively, they can share important information, provide feedback, and address issues quickly. This open line of communication ensures that everyone is on the same page and working towards the same objectives.

Benefits of Effective Communication:

  • Clarity: Clear communication helps team members understand their roles and responsibilities.
  • Feedback: Constructive feedback helps individuals improve their performance.
  • Problem-Solving: Open communication fosters a collaborative approach to solving problems.

Sharing Knowledge and Skills

In a collaborative environment, team members are more likely to share their knowledge and skills with each other. This sharing of information helps everyone learn and grow, leading to a more skilled and competent team. For example, a team member with expertise in a particular area can train others, enhancing the overall skill set of the team.

Advantages of Knowledge Sharing:

  • Skill Development: Team members can learn new skills and improve existing ones.
  • Innovation: Sharing different perspectives can lead to innovative solutions.
  • Consistency: Knowledge sharing ensures that all team members are well-informed and capable.

Building Trust and Relationships

Strong teamwork is built on trust. When team members trust each other, they are more likely to collaborate effectively. Trust creates a positive work environment where individuals feel valued and respected. This sense of trust and camaraderie can significantly boost morale and motivation.

How Trust Benefits the Team:

  • Confidence: Team members are more confident in their abilities and decisions.
  • Support: A trusting team provides mutual support and encouragement.
  • Resilience: Trust helps teams navigate challenges and setbacks more effectively.

Enhancing Problem-Solving

Collaboration enhances problem-solving capabilities. When faced with a challenge, a team that works well together can brainstorm and come up with creative solutions. The diverse perspectives within a team lead to a more comprehensive understanding of problems and more effective solutions.

Collaborative Problem-Solving:

  • Brainstorming: Teams can generate a wide range of ideas and solutions.
  • Multiple Perspectives: Different viewpoints lead to a deeper understanding of issues.
  • Resource Pooling: Teams can combine resources and expertise to tackle problems.

Increasing Accountability

In a collaborative environment, team members hold each other accountable. This mutual accountability ensures that everyone stays on track and meets their responsibilities. When team members know that others are depending on them, they are more likely to put in their best effort.

Accountability in Teams:

  • Commitment: Team members are more committed to their goals.
  • Responsibility: Individuals take responsibility for their actions and contributions.
  • Performance: High levels of accountability lead to better performance and results.

Encouraging Innovation

The power of collaboration fosters an innovative culture. When team members work together and share ideas, they are more likely to come up with creative solutions and new approaches. This innovation is crucial for staying competitive in the fast-paced world of sales.

Innovation Through Teamwork:

  • Creativity: Team members can inspire each other to think creatively.
  • Adaptability: Collaborative teams are better at adapting to changes and new trends.
  • Competitive Edge: Innovation gives teams a competitive advantage in the market.

Celebrating Success Together

Finally, collaboration allows teams to celebrate their successes together. When a team achieves its goals, the sense of shared accomplishment is incredibly rewarding. Celebrating together strengthens the bonds between team members and reinforces the importance of teamwork.

Benefits of Celebrating Success:

  • Motivation: Celebrations boost morale and motivation.
  • Recognition: Team members feel valued and appreciated.
  • Cohesion: Celebrating together strengthens team cohesion and unity.

Conclusion

The power of collaboration in sales cannot be overstated. Strong teamwork leads to improved communication, shared knowledge, trust, enhanced problem-solving, increased accountability, and innovation. By fostering a collaborative environment, sales teams can achieve greater success and drive their company forward. Remember, in sales, as in many areas of life, we achieve more together than we ever could alone.
